IPrintDialogCallback::InitDone-Methode (commdlg.h)
Wird von PrintDlgEx aufgerufen, wenn das System die Seite Allgemein des Druckeigenschaftenblatts initialisiert hat.
Syntax
HRESULT InitDone();
Rückgabewert
Typ: HRESULT
Geben Sie S_OK zurück, um zu verhindern, dass die PrintDlgEx-Funktion ihre Standardaktionen ausführt.
Geben Sie S_FALSE zurück, damit PrintDlgEx die Standardaktionen ausführen kann. Derzeit führt PrintDlgEx nach dem InitDone-Aufruf keine Standardverarbeitung aus.
Hinweise
Wenn Ihr Rückrufobjekt die IObjectWithSite-Schnittstelle implementiert, ruft die PrintDlgEx-Funktion die IObjectWithSite::SetSite-Methode auf, um einen IPrintDialogServices-Zeiger auf das Rückrufobjekt zu übergeben. Die PrintDlgEx-Funktion ruft die IObjectWithSite::SetSite-Methode auf, bevor die InitDone-Methode aufgerufen wird. Dadurch kann Ihre InitDone-Implementierung die IPrintDialogServices-Methoden verwenden, um Informationen zum aktuell ausgewählten Drucker abzurufen.
Anforderungen
Unterstützte Mindestversion (Client) | Windows 2000 Professional [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) | Windows 2000 Server [nur Desktop-Apps] |
Zielplattform | Windows |
Kopfzeile | commdlg.h (windows.h einschließen) |
DLL | Comdlg32.dll |
Weitere Informationen
Allgemeine Dialogfeldbibliothek
Konzept
Referenz